Analysis
Equatorial Guinea recorded 1.14 million constant LCU per person for services, value added (constant lcu), per capita in 2025.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 0.3% on the previous year and down 16.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, services, value added (constant lcu), per capita in Equatorial Guinea peaked at 1.50 million constant LCU per person in 2013 and was at its lowest, 835,657 constant LCU per person, in 2006.
Equatorial Guinea ranks 22nd of 197 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

How this figure is calculated
Services, value added (constant LCU)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Services, value added (constant LCU) ÷ Population, total
Computed from
- Services, value added Country official statistics, National Statistical Offices (NSOs)
- Population, total World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
